First things first, let's understand what interest rates are and how they work. Interest rates are the percentage of the loan amount that you will pay back to the lender in addition to the original amount borrowed. This is the cost of borrowing money and is determined by various factors such as your credit score, income, and the length of the loan. Generally, the better your credit score and financial stability, the lower your interest rate will be.
Now, let's get to the good stuff - the current interest rates for boat loans. To give you a better understanding of the current market, here is a chart showing the average interest rates for boat loans over the last 30 days:
Loan Term Interest Rate (APR)
5 years 7.49% - 25.49%
10 years 8.49% - 35.97%
15 years 8.99% - 35.49%
20 years 8.99% - 35.99%
Please note that these rates may vary based on individual factors and lenders, but this gives you a general idea of what to expect. Now, let's break down these rates and compare them to help you choose the best one for your boat loan.
5-year loan term: A shorter loan term will typically have a lower interest rate, but this also means a higher monthly payment.
10-year loan term: This is the most common loan term for boat loans and offers a moderate interest rate and manageable monthly payments.
15-year loan term: A longer loan term means a lower monthly payment, but a slightly higher interest rate.
20-year loan term: This is the longest loan term available for boat loans and offers the lowest monthly payment, but with a higher interest rate.
Now that you have a better understanding of the current interest rates, let's look at some factors that can affect these rates and how you can improve your chances of getting the best rate for your boat loan.
- Credit Score: As mentioned earlier, your credit score plays a significant role in determining your interest rate. The higher your credit score, the more likely you are to get a lower interest rate. Make sure to check your credit score before applying for a boat loan and take steps to improve it if needed.
- Down Payment: A larger down payment can also help you secure a lower interest rate. Lenders may view you as a less risky borrower if you have a substantial down payment and may offer you a better rate.
- Income and Debt-to-Income Ratio: Lenders also consider your income and debt-to-income ratio when determining your interest rate. A higher income and lower debt-to-income ratio can help you qualify for a lower interest rate.
- Type of Boat: The type of boat you are looking to finance can also affect your interest rate. For example, a new boat may have a lower rate compared to a used one, as it is seen as less risky by lenders.
In addition to these factors, it's essential to shop around and compare rates from different lenders. Don't settle for the first offer you receive, as you may be able to find a better rate elsewhere. Another tip is to consider your overall financial situation before deciding on a loan term. A shorter loan term may have a higher monthly payment, but you'll end up paying less in interest over the life of the loan. On the other hand, a longer loan term may have a lower monthly payment, but you'll end up paying more in interest over time. Consider your budget and choose a loan term that works best for you. Also, choosing a lender with no pre-payment penalty allows you to go long on the loan with lower payments, but you can speed-up your payment process to shorten the life of the loan. This also reduces the overall amount of interest you'll pay on the loan.
Lastly, make sure to read the fine print and understand all the terms and conditions of the 20 year boat loan before signing on the dotted line. Look out for any hidden fees or charges that may affect the overall cost of the loan.
